Unveiling the Truth- Does HTTPS Really Mean Secure-
Does HTTPS Mean Secure?
In today’s digital age, where online transactions and communication are more prevalent than ever, the question of whether HTTPS means secure is of paramount importance. With the increasing number of cyber threats and data breaches, it is crucial to understand the implications of using HTTPS and its role in ensuring online security.
HTTPS, which stands for Hypertext Transfer Protocol Secure, is an extension of the HTTP protocol that provides secure communication over a computer network. It ensures that the data transmitted between a user’s device and a website is encrypted, making it difficult for hackers to intercept and read the information. The addition of “S” in HTTPS signifies the secure layer that is added to the standard HTTP protocol.
Understanding the Basics of HTTPS
To grasp the concept of HTTPS and its significance in ensuring security, it is essential to understand the basics. When a user accesses a website, the data is typically transmitted in plain text, which means that anyone with access to the network can read the information. However, with HTTPS, the data is encrypted using SSL/TLS (Secure Sockets Layer/Transport Layer Security) protocols, making it unreadable to unauthorized individuals.
The encryption process involves the use of public and private keys. The public key is used to encrypt the data, while the private key is used to decrypt it. This ensures that only the intended recipient can access the information, thereby protecting it from potential eavesdroppers.
Why HTTPS is Considered Secure
HTTPS is considered secure for several reasons. Firstly, it provides authentication, ensuring that the user is communicating with the intended website and not an imposter. This is achieved through digital certificates issued by trusted certificate authorities (CAs). These certificates verify the identity of the website and establish a secure connection.
Secondly, HTTPS encrypts the data, making it difficult for hackers to intercept and read the information. This is particularly important when sensitive data, such as login credentials or financial information, is being transmitted.
Furthermore, HTTPS provides integrity, ensuring that the data has not been tampered with during transmission. This is achieved through the use of digital signatures, which verify the authenticity and integrity of the data.
Is HTTPS Foolproof?
While HTTPS is a crucial component of online security, it is not foolproof. There are still potential vulnerabilities that can be exploited by skilled hackers. For instance, weak encryption algorithms or outdated SSL/TLS protocols can be targeted, allowing attackers to bypass the security measures.
Moreover, HTTPS does not guarantee the security of the entire website. It only protects the data transmitted between the user’s device and the website. Other aspects, such as the website’s server configuration and the security practices of the website owner, also play a significant role in ensuring overall security.
Conclusion
In conclusion, while HTTPS is a fundamental component of online security, it is not a guarantee of complete safety. By encrypting data and providing authentication, HTTPS helps protect sensitive information from being intercepted and read by unauthorized individuals. However, it is crucial for users to remain vigilant and take additional security measures, such as using strong passwords, being cautious of phishing attempts, and regularly updating their software, to ensure a comprehensive level of online security.